/* Single */
#content-left { float:left; margin:0 0 0 10px; width:640px; }
	#options { float:left; margin:10px 0 0 26px; padding:8px; width:591px; border:1px dotted #CCC; }
		#font-size { float:right; background:#EEE; }
		#font-size span { float:left; display:inline-block; padding:4px 8px; background:#F5F5F5; }
		#font-size div { float:left; margin:0 3px 0 3px; padding:3px 9px; border:1px solid #888; background:#FFF; cursor:pointer; }
		#font-size div.active { padding:2px 8px; color:#369; border:2px solid #47A; }
	#post { float:left; margin:10px 0 0 26px; padding:25px; width:555px; border:2px solid #DDD; background:#FFF; }
		#navi-post { float:left; margin:0 0 20px -50px; width:640px; }
		#navi-post div { display:inline; float:left; padding:0 0 0 6px; background:url(http://static.inwtrend.com/_images/navi-1.gif) top left; }
		#navi-post div a, #navi-post strong { display:block; float:left; height:16px; }
		#navi-post div a { padding:14px 22px 14px 16px; color:#FFF; font-weight:bold; text-shadow:0 1px 0 #47A; background:url(http://static.inwtrend.com/_images/navi-1.gif) top right; }
		#navi-post div a:hover { color:#FD0; }
		#navi-post strong { padding:14px 22px 14px 0; color:#BBB; font-weight:normal; }
		#navi-post span { display:block; float:left; padding:14px 8px; height:16px; }
		#post h1 { float:left; width:100%; font-size:18px; }
		#postmetadata { float:left; margin:10px 0 0 0; width:100%; color:#999; font-size:11px; }
		#entry { float:left; margin:6px 0 0 0; width:100%; }
		#entry p { clear:both; float:left; margin:20px 0 0 0; width:100%; color:#555; font-size:13px; text-indent:25px; }
		#entry p img { display:block; margin:0 auto; padding:5px; border:1px dotted #AAA; }
		#entry p small { display:block; width:100%; margin:12px auto 0 auto; color:#777; font-size:11px; text-align:center; text-indent:0; }
		#entry p.no-indent { text-indent:0; }
		#entry p.youtube { display:block; clear:both; float:left; margin:25px 0 5px 71px; padding:5px; width:400px; text-indent:0; border:1px dotted #AAA; }
		#entry p.youtube img { padding:0; border:0; }
		#entry blockquote { clear:both; float:left; margin:20px 0 0 25px; padding:15px 25px; width:453px; border:1px dashed #EEE; background:#FAFAFA; }
		#entry blockquote p { margin:0; padding:10px 0; }
		#entry table { clear:both; float:left; margin:20px 0 0 0; padding:0; width:100%; color:#555; font-size:13px; border:0; }
		#entry table tr, #entry table tr td { margin:0; padding:0; }
		#entry ul { display:block; float:left; margin:10px 0 0 0; width:100%; }
		#entry ul li { list-style:square; margin:0 0 0 25px; color:#555; }
		#tags, #sources { float:left; width:100%; color:#666; }
		#tags { margin:30px 0 0 0; font-size:13px; }
		#tags a { font-weight:bold; }
		#sources { margin:15px 0 0 0; font-size:11px; line-height:15px; }
	#share { float:left; width:535px; margin:10px 0 0 51px; padding:8px 11px; border:1px dotted #CCC; }
	#related-posts { float:left; margin:25px 0 0 40px; width:568px; }
		#related-posts strong { float:left; margin:0 0 10px 0; width:100%; text-indent:14px; }
		#related-posts li { clear:both; list-style:none; }
		#related-posts li a { display:inline-block; float:left; padding:0 0 4px 32px; background:url(http://static.inwtrend.com/_images/bullet-1.gif) 12px 2px no-repeat; }
		#related-posts li span { float:left; padding:2px; color:#999; font-size:11px; }
	#comments-wrapper { float:left; margin:30px 0 0 53px; width:565px; }
		h3 #comments { float:left; width:100%; }
		.navi-comments { float:left; margin:20px 0 15px 0; width:100%; text-align:center; }
			span.page-numbers { display:inline-block; margin:0 0 0 3px; padding:2px 8px; color:#FFF; font-weight:bold; border:1px solid #369; background:#58B; }
			a.page-numbers { display:inline-block; margin:0 0 0 3px; padding:2px 8px; color:#47A; border:1px solid #789; background:#FFF; }
			a:hover.page-numbers { color:#FFF; border:1px solid #369; background:#58B; }
		ul.commentlist { display:block; float:left; }
			li.comment { display:block; list-style:none; float:left; margin:5px 0 0 0; padding:10px; width:533px; border:1px dotted #CCC; background:#FFF; }
			.commentmetadata { float:left; padding:0 10px 0 0; width:100px; border-right:1px solid #EEE; }
			.commentmetadata span.number, .commentmetadata span.reply { display:block; float:right; margin:5px 0 0 0; padding:5px 0; width:95px; color:#BBB; font-weight:bold; text-align:right; border-bottom:1px solid #EEE; background:#FFF; }
			.commentmetadata span.number { font-size:19px; }
			.commentmetadata span.date, .commentmetadata span.time { float:right; margin:5px 0 0 0; width:100%; color:#BBB; font-size:11px; text-align:right; }
			.comment-author { float:left; margin:0 0 0 14px; font-size:11px; }
			.comment-author cite.fn { padding:0 0 0 20px; font-style:normal; font-weight:bold; background:url(http://static.inwtrend.com/_images/bullet-3.gif) 0 2px no-repeat; }
			.comment-text { float:right; margin:10px 5px 0 0; padding:0 14px; width:373px; border:1px dotted #DDD; background:#F1F1F1; }
			.comment-text p { margin:6px 0 6px 0; }
			.avatar { float:right; padding:5px; border:1px dotted #DDD; }
			li.comment.byuser div div.comment-author cite { color:#47A; }
			li.comment #respond { clear:both; float:right; margin:10px 0 0 0; width:509px; }
			ul.children { display:block; clear:right; float:right; margin:5px 5px 0 0; width:403px; }
			ul.children li.depth-2 { width:381px;}
			ul.children li.depth-2 .comment-text { width:221px; }
			div.reply { clear:right; float:right; margin:8px 5px 0 0; }
			div.reply a { color:#39F; font-size:11px; font-weight:bold; }
			div.reply a:hover { color:#F90; }
			div.comment-mod { clear:right; float:right; margin:8px 5px 0 0; font-size:11px; }
		#respond { float:left; margin:10px 0 0 0; padding:10px; width:531px; border:2px solid #47A; background:#E5E5FF; }
			#respond h4 { float:left; }
			#respond strong { clear:left; float:left; padding:4px 0; color:#555; font-size:11px; }
			#respond p { float:left; margin:3px 0; width:100%; }
			#respond p input#author, #respond p input#captcha { float:left; padding:5px; width:114px; height:15px; font-size:11px; border:1px solid #BBB; }
			#respond p textarea#comment { float:left; padding:5px; margin:8px 0 0 0; width:300px; height:150px; border:1px solid #BBB; }
			#respond p input#submit { float:left; margin:8px 0 0 0; padding:5px 10px; }
			#respond p label { float:left; padding:6px; height:15px; color:#555; font-size:11px; }
			#respond p img { padding:2px; border:1px solid #89A; background:#FFF; }
			#respond div#fbc_login { float:left; margin:0 0 0 0; padding:20px 0; width:100%; }
			#respond a { font-weight:bold; }
			#respond a#cancel-comment-reply-link { float:right; padding:2px 8px; color:#C03; border:2px solid #C03; background:#FFF; }

#content-right { float:right; margin:10px 3px 0 0; padding:2px 6px 6px 6px; width:316px; border:1px dotted #CCC; }
	#latest-in-cat { float:left; padding:0 0 15px 0; width:308px; border:1px solid #C4C4C4; background:#FFF; }
		#latest-in-cat h2 { padding:12px 12px 12px 20px; width:276px; }
		#latest-in-cat li { list-style:none; }
		#latest-in-cat li a { display:inline-block; float:left; padding:0 0 4px 32px; width:266px; background:url(http://static.inwtrend.com/_images/bullet-1.gif) 12px 2px no-repeat; }
	#ads-B { float:right; margin:5px 3px 0 0; padding:3px; width:300px; height:250px; }
	#ads-F-2 { float:left; width:308px; min-height:117px; border:1px solid #C4C4C4; background:#FFF; }
	#ads-F-2 div { float:left; margin:12px 0 15px 20px; }

.blue { color:#36F; }
.green { color:#3C0; }
.orange { color:#F90; }
.pink { color:#F39; }
.red { color:#F30; }
.white { color:#FFF; }

.bold { font-weight:bold; }